Transaction 43f37b421116b1edc10c183b56280f286b64742875627c6cb5748392f4683827
1 Input
1 Output
-
43f37b421116b1edc10c183b56280f286b64742875627c6cb5748392f4683827:0
- value
- 308265
- script pubkey
- OP_0 OP_PUSHBYTES_32 babc21a23e8d26be9445c341fa0080652340eafe7aba4fd50d9720e5870c5a6e
- address
- bc1qh27zrg3735nta9z9cdql5qyqv535p6h702ayl4gdjuswtpcvtfhqafssmk